A number having 7 at its ones place will have 3 at the ones place of its cube.
पर्याय
True
False
Advertisements
उत्तर
This statement is True.
Explanation:
Cube of 7 = 7 × 7 × 7 = 343
Cube of 17 = 17 × 17 × 17 = 4913
Cube of 27 = 27 × 27 × 27 = 19683
And so on.
